The 56,000-acre lake is one of the biggest recreationlakes in the Southeastand is well-known for its world-class fishing.

If fishing isn’t your fancy, head to Big Water Marina and take your pick of watercrafts.

They’ve got everything from kayaks, paddle boards, and hydrobikes to pontoon boats.

The city’s only boutique hotel, the Bleckley offers 22 well-appointed rooms in the heart of downtown.

The renovated historic building features dramatic 10-foot ceilings, original heart pine flooring, and classic Southern decor.
